Registered Nurse (RN) – Full‑Time Nights
* Additional $5/hr differential for all hours worked
Utilizing the Nursing Process of ass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luating, the Staff Registered Nurse is responsible for delivery of patient care: managing assigned personnel, and promoting collaboration among the multi-disciplinary health care team.
Core Job Functions- Assessment and reassessment are completed and changes in status are communicated to appropriate care provider. Plan of care is formulated and modified based on evaluation. Collaborates with disciplinary health care team to improve patient outcomes.
- Engages resources to facilitate timely discharge and throughput starting on admission. Anticipates forecasted patient care discharge needs to ensure throughput targets met. Provides input that decreases inefficiencies for unit, staff in collaboration with the manager.
- Utilizes Teach Back technique to assess understanding of education. Assesses needs for discharge and the best way the patient may be provided instruction. Utilizes appropriate written communication, education packets and/or audio‑video instructions. Teach back performed with patients to facilitate patient outcome improvements by increasing knowledge and skills needed to improve healthy behaviors. Elicit information using effective counseling techniques. Identify factors that might affect communication or learning.
- Care plan developed and implemented with other health care team members. Is a resource for others in the delivery of timely professional communication with physicians regarding Situation, Background, Assessment, and Recommendation format. Is a resource for assuring consistent rounding and communicating including present on admission indicators.
- Complies with regulatory guidelines for work area and professional practice standards. Utilizes available safety equipment and processes for patient care. Promotes a safe and therapeutic environment for patients.
- Administers medication utilizing the 5 rights and available safety equipment and processes. Utilizes clinical judgment with patient assessment and prescribed therapies to ensure promotion of goal obtainment. As a leader holds healthcare providers accountable for the standard of care.
- Associates in Nursing – Required
- 2 – 3 Years – Required
- Medical/Surgical and/or Critical Care in a hospital within the last five years preferred
- Registered Nurse License – License with State of Practice – Required
- Basic Life Support (BLS) – Required
-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S) – Required for Critical Care units
-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) – Required for PACU and ED units
